    Also, wag ka maniwala sa specs ng mga car manufacturers.

    The Hilux is advertised to have 450nm pero barely feels like it.

    The strada has 400nm lang pero is blistering fast.

    The D-max has 360nm lang pero feels like it has more.

    The ranger has 385nm? Pero feels like it has more, parang d-max.
